Persist sidebar (folder list) state
Last modified: 2021-07-05 13:24:46 UTC
---- Reported by jim@yorba.org 2013-02-05 12:37:00 -0800 ---- Original Redmine bug id: 6325 Original URL: http://redmine.yorba.org/issues/6325 Searchable id: yorba-bug-6325 Original author: Jim Nelson Original description: Geary should remember how the sidebar is configured (nodes opened, closed) between runs of the application. We should also remember which folder was selected and, if possible, the conversation as well. I'd love to see this feature implemented as well. In my case it's mainly interesting for the label list. Some I prefer to have expanded by default, some I prefer to have collapsed by default. With a lot of labels it's a pain to have to do it every time I start Geary.
I have the same problem. Having to expand all the folders for all accounts on every start is tiresome. Especially because there is no way to know if there are unread messages "hidden". Unread counts are only shown on individual labels and not on the parent.
